The candidate who may apply for the admission to a doctoral school of the Medical University must be a relevant higher education school graduate who:
1. holds a Master of Science or a Master of Engineering or an equivalent degree;
2. obtained a written consent of the proposed doctoral research supervisor to oversee a PhD candidate’s work on doctoral dissertation;
3. has level of English on B2 level;
4. is not a doctoral student at any other doctoral school.
The candidate is obliged to registered in University electronic recruitment system, later submit the documents to the recruitment committee – via The Office of Doctoral School, by the dates specified in the recruitment schedule of chosen Doctoral School – original documents indicated in § 9 of the Resolution on the rules of recruitment to the doctoral school for the academic year 2025/2026.
The full set of documents shall be submitted in a signed white cardboard folder between 1st and 15th July 2025 after making a prior appointment at The Office of Doctoral School by e-mail sent to: cod@umed.lodz.pl with the following e-mail subject: name and surname – IDS recruitment or SMM – appointment booking or by calling.
In the case of foreigners, it is allowed to send scans of the documents referred to in § 9 via e-mail, provided that these documents will be sent within the deadline specified in the recruitment plan, and the original documents will be delivered to the Recruitment Committee via the Doctoral School Office, no later than:
In the cases referred to above, the date of submitting the documents is the date of sending the e-mail containing document scans.
When submitting documents to the Office of Doctoral School, the candidate is obliged to present an identity document.
Documents submitted after the aforementioned date will not be accepted for recruitment procedures to Doctoral Schools.
